Why Choose Professional Loft Clearance Over Skip Hire?
Skip hire might seem like the obvious choice, but Compton residents quickly discover the hidden complications. You'll need council permission to place a skip on the road (£60-90 permit, several days' wait), neighbours won't thank you for the parking obstruction, and you're still doing all the physical work yourself—carrying heavy items down from the loft, through your home, and heaving them into the skip.
Our wait-and-load service eliminates every one of these frustrations. No permits required. No rusted metal container sitting outside your property for a week. No risk of injury wrestling a waterlogged mattress down a narrow staircase. We arrive, we clear, we're gone—often within the same day.
The cost comparison often surprises people too. By the time you've paid skip hire, permit fees, and potentially taken time off work to coordinate delivery and collection, our all-inclusive price becomes remarkably competitive. Plus, we achieve up to 90% recycling and landfill diversion rates—far better than typical skip disposal.
What We Remove from Lofts Across Compton
Our licensed waste carriers handle the full spectrum of household and commercial items typically stored in loft spaces:
- Furniture: sofas, armchairs, dining sets, wardrobes, bed frames, mattresses (any size or condition)
- White goods and appliances: fridges, freezers, washing machines, dishwashers, cookers (WEEE-registered disposal)
- General household items: toys, books, clothing, boxes of miscellaneous clutter, old suitcases
- Garden waste: artificial turf, patio furniture, garden tools, plant pots
- Renovation waste: old carpets, curtains, light fittings, non-hazardous building materials
- Office clearance: desks, filing cabinets, electronic equipment, paperwork
Items we cannot accept: asbestos-containing materials, gas bottles, chemicals, paints, oils, medical waste, or hazardous substances. If you're unsure whether something qualifies, ask when you call—we'll advise on proper disposal routes.
Anything suitable for reuse or donation goes to local charities and community organisations rather than straight to recycling centres, extending the life of items that still have value.

Do you provide waste transfer notes and proper licensing?
Absolutely. We're fully licensed waste carriers registered with the Environment Agency, carrying £5 million public liability insurance. You'll receive a waste transfer note after every clearance detailing what was removed and where it went—your legal proof of responsible disposal. This matters if you're a landlord, managing an estate, or simply want assurance your waste isn't fly-tipped.
What happens to the items you collect from my loft?
We operate a recycling-first approach, sorting everything at licensed facilities. Usable furniture and goods go to local charities and reuse organisations. Metals, wood, plastics and textiles are separated for recycling. White goods receive specialist WEEE treatment. Only true waste reaches landfill—typically less than 10% of what we collect. You'll receive a breakdown with your waste transfer note.
